淮北平原区节水减排面临的问题和对策

摘要 分析了淮北平原旱作区的特点,开展节水减排研究,以期有效提高淮北平原地区的水资源利用效率,缓解水资源供需矛盾,减少农田面源污染排放,为保障国家粮食安全和建设水美乡村提供技术支撑。
